Laborers Training School Taking Shape

When complete, the Southern California Laborer's Training Retraining and Apprenticeship School, located at 1385 W. Sierra Madre Avenue, Azusa, will be ready to provide your employees with cutting edge training.

The training campus will be comprised of three core buildings.  

  • The Quevedo Administrative Building, named after Mike Quevedo, Jr., contains three large lecture halls, locker facility, Board room, lunch room and administrative offices.
  • O'Sullivan Hall, named after General President Terence M. O'Sullivan, houses the field office and Logistics, Safety and Personnel offices.  The hall also contains indoor/outdoor classrooms for industry and certification classes.
  • Poss Hall, named after Chuck Poss of C.W. Poss Company, houses all campus shops for welding, maintenance and vehicle and tool service.
